OnePlus 7 Pro with 6.67-inch Quad HD+ Fluid AMOLED 90Hz display, Snapdragon 855, up to 12GB RAM launched in India starting at Rs. 48999

OnePlus just launched its flagship OnePlus 7 Pro smartphone at global launch events, as it had promised. It has a 6.67-inch Fluid AMOLED display without a notch, 90Hz refresh rate, is powered by Snapdragon 855 Mobile Platform with up to 12GB of RAM with RAM Boost, 10-layer liquid cooling and runs Android 9.0 (Pie) with OxygenOS 9.0 on top with built-in Screen Recorder and Zen Mode that will run for 20 minutes so you can receive only emergency calls and take quick photos. It has a pop-up 16MP front facing camera, and the company says that the elevating mechanism has been tested over 300,000 times. On the back there is a 48-megapixel Sony IMX586 sensor with 7-element plastic lens with an aperture of f/1.6, OIS and EIS support. There is also a 78mm 8-megapixel telephoto lens with an f/2.4 aperture, 1μm pixel size and OIS offering 3x loss-less zoom. Along with this there is a 16-megapixel 117° Ultra Wide Angle Lens with an aperture of f/2.2 aperture. At the event the company said that it has scored 111 points in DxOMark mobile.
